What is the interpretation of the recurring dream of the dreamer marrying his paternal uncle's daughter, who reciprocates the same feelings, given that they are not married?

Your female cousin must observe the full, শরعي (Shar'i) in front of you, just as she would with strangers, because you are a non- to her. You, in turn, must lower your gaze from her and not be alone with her in seclusion (). The fact that you shared a childhood does not alter the Shar'i ruling, and the parents' consent to her not wearing hijab is of no consequence.
If you love your female cousin and she reciprocates your love, we advise you to marry her; this is the only Shar'i path for a relationship between you. As for the dream you saw, it does not entail any Shar'i consequence in terms of sin.
